代码生成 AI 工具的应用与软件开发效率提升

```html 代码生成 AI 工具的应用与软件开发效率提升

代码生成 AI 工具的应用与软件开发效率提升

随着人工智能技术的飞速发展,代码生成AI工具逐渐成为软件开发领域的重要组成部分。这些工具利用先进的机器学习算法和自然语言处理技术,能够根据用户的需求自动生成代码片段、模块甚至完整的应用程序。这种能力不仅极大地提高了开发效率,还为开发者提供了更多的创新空间。

什么是代码生成AI工具?

代码生成AI工具是一种基于人工智能的编程辅助系统,它通过分析大量的开源代码库,学习各种编程语言的语法结构和设计模式。当开发者输入需求或部分代码时,AI工具可以快速生成相应的代码实现方案。这类工具通常支持多种编程语言,并且可以根据项目的具体需求进行定制化配置。

代码生成AI工具的优势

首先,代码生成AI工具显著提升了开发速度。传统的手动编写代码需要耗费大量时间去查找资料、调试错误等,而使用AI工具后,许多重复性工作都可以由机器自动完成。例如,在处理复杂的逻辑判断或者数据处理任务时,AI工具往往能够在几秒钟内提供多个优化后的解决方案供选择。

其次,代码生成AI工具有助于降低入门门槛。对于初学者而言,理解复杂的代码逻辑是一项挑战,但借助于AI工具的帮助,他们可以更轻松地掌握基本概念并逐步提高自己的技能水平。同时,经验丰富的程序员也可以从中受益匪浅,因为这些工具可以帮助他们发现潜在的问题并提出改进建议。

实际应用场景

代码生成AI工具已经在多个行业得到了广泛应用。在Web开发中,开发者可以通过输入简单的描述来创建网页布局;在移动应用开发过程中,则能快速搭建起用户界面框架。此外,在大数据分析、云计算等领域,此类工具同样发挥着重要作用,帮助企业节省成本的同时加快项目进度。

面临的挑战与未来展望

尽管代码生成AI工具带来了诸多便利,但也存在一些亟待解决的问题。一方面,由于训练数据的质量直接影响到输出结果的好坏,因此如何获取高质量的数据集仍然是一个难题;另一方面,随着技术的进步,如何确保生成的代码符合安全标准也是一个值得深思的话题。展望未来,我们期待看到更加智能化、个性化的代码生成平台出现,它们将更好地服务于全球范围内的开发者群体。

结语

总而言之,代码生成AI工具正在改变传统软件开发的方式,使整个流程变得更加高效便捷。相信随着时间推移,这项技术将会不断完善,并为更多领域的创新奠定坚实基础。作为从业者,我们应该积极拥抱变化,充分利用好这些强大的工具,共同推动科技进步与发展。

```

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值